BILL A LEAD ONLY.
State arbitration- t.rnmnaTs will deteriniilo the starting and tinishing times of indnstrv under the Forty Honr Week P>ill, said the Minister of Labour and Industry, Mr. Hamilton Knight. The Bill wil'l not say how a week shall be worked but merely declare that it is a lead for all people working under State awards. Whether industries shall work Saturdav mornings or close on that day will be a matter for individual agreement between employers and employees or for application to tlie rndustVial Commission for a variation, of awards. . : • .
